The TOP EVO KIT 29200E is the ideal solution for the automation of medium and large swing gates up to 3.5 meters per leaf. Thanks to 230Vac hydraulic technology, this system is designed to ensure maximum power, resistance and reliability even in conditions of intensive use, in residential and commercial environments.

Kit Contents

  • 2x TOP EVO 230Vac Hydraulic Actuators

  • 1x Dedicated control unit

(Accessories such as photocells, flashing lights, remote controls and brackets are not included in the kit and must be purchased separately)


Main features

  • Powerful and versatile: 230Vac hydraulic actuators, perfect for swing gates up to 3.5m in length.

  • Reinforced structure: new die-cast aluminum back and oversized tie rods to ensure strength and durability.

  • Configurable modes: integrated valves to set operation in reversible, irreversible or mixed mode, both in opening and closing.

  • Hydraulic reliability: designed to guarantee high performance even with intensive manoeuvring cycles.

  • Simplified installation: control unit already set up to fully manage actuators and optional safety devices.

  • Intensive use: ideal hydraulic technology for private residences, condominiums and areas with high vehicular traffic.


Applications

  • Residential swing gates up to 3.5m per leaf

  • Condos and common areas with frequent footfall

  • Medium-intensity commercial or industrial entrances
